Women’s Health in the Workplace
Workplaces provide opportunities to incorporate healthy lifestyles into everyday activities. According to a 2016 Mercer report, “When Women Thrive, Businesses Thrive”, workplace health programs can be a key factor in a company’s long-term ability to engage and retain female talent in its workforce and improve gender diversity.
